Get ready for the 14th annual “Rock Back the Clock” family street dance scheduled 6-10 p.m., Sept. 6, at Rancho Shopping Center, Foothill Expressway and Springer Road in Los Altos.
The event provides an inexpensive evening for the family. Kids can dance and hula-hoop their hearts out to 1950s hit songs.
Disc Jockey Rens Boorsma will set up his 10-foot music rack with Bose speakers and get the crowd in a dancing mood with songs such as “Tequila,” “Louie, Louie” and “Joy to the World.”
The Rancho Merchants Association hosts Rock Back the Clock. Proceeds benefit the Los Altos Festival of Lights parade held downtown every Thanksgiving weekend.
Kevin Sawyer, annual chairman of the event, coordinates the Rancho merchants who volunteer their time after the stores close.
“We want to liven up the event this year with a few new surprises and new games for the kids,” Sawyer said.
The annual event includes a hula-hoop contest for all ages. Putting the right spin on “Peppermint Twist” can win a prize from the merchants.
Admission is $5 per person and those under 18 will be admitted free if accompanied by an adult.
